发明名称 DISCHARGE ELECTRODE MATERIAL AND ITS MANUFACTURE
摘要 PROBLEM TO BE SOLVED: To provide a discharge electrode material which has higher perfor mance than a tungsten electrode added with thorium oxide and which can endure use under more severe conditions and a method for manufacturing the same. SOLUTION: A discharge electrode material contains 0.1 to 15.0 wt.% Re, 0.1 to 1.0 wt.% rare earth oxides, and the rest substantially being tungsten, the rare earth oxides being at least one kind selected from among La2 O3 , CeO2 , and Y2 O3 and being excellent in arc ignitability and wear resistance. In a method for manufacturing the discharge electrode material, plastic working is performed on an ingot obtained when tungsten powders, Re powders, and rare earth oxide powders are mixed to achieve the above composition, then press molded, temporarily sintered, and sintered. The rare earth oxides consist of at least one kind selected from among La2 O3 , CeO2 , and Y2 O3 .
